Set within the stunning Peak District National Park, the estate comprises of 30 acres of woodland, gardens and 90 acres of Kinder Reservoir. Sat atop the beautiful countryside is the castle itself. Breathtaking vistas
Wedding photographers can use the beautiful Kinder Reservoir as a backdrop. From here you can see over miles and miles of countryside. The vistas are truly breathtaking, couples who choose to marry at Upper House Hayfield are advised to set aside a good amount of time for portraits as there are so many stunning backdrops you will want to include. As there is a huge amount of space on offer planning is key. Meet with your Upper House wedding photographer before the day and discuss what photographs are important to you.
